2012 NASCOE

Legislative Conference

 

Your NASCOE Legislative Committee is pleased to announce a 2012 Legislative Conference.  This year’s conference will be a full conference.  NASCOE invites and encourages all states to participate.  Our venue for the conference will be the Marriott Metro Center from February 6, 2012 through February 9, 2012.  Below is an abbreviated agenda for this year’s conference.

 

2/6/12     Travel Day for Conference Attendees

                5:30pm—7:30 pm   NASCOE Reception

2/7/12     Legislative Training

 8:30am—3:00pm  

     Legislative Update from Bob Redding

                   Position Paper Discussions

                   Legislative Report Card Process

2/8/12     NASCOE visits Capitol Hill

               6:00pm—7:00pm   Face-to Face Feedback from Key States (All are welcome to attend)

2/9/12     NASCOE visits Capitol Hill (if necessary)

               Travel Day for Conference Attendees

 

The Legislative Committee is currently working on developing position papers for the conference.  A conference package including the full agenda and the final position papers will be distributed to conference attendees prior to arrival in WDC.  For this year’s conference, NASCOE has approved a stipend of $750.00 per state.  Additional hotel information to allow states to make necessary room reservations will be forthcoming in the near future.

 

Thank you for participating in NASCOE’s 2012 Legislative Conference.  We look forward to seeing everyone in our nation’s capitol in February.

 2012 NASCOE PAC PROMOTION

 

            The Executive board has recognized the importance of the NASCOE PAC in perpetuating the existence and benefits of the NASCOE membership.  The board approved the issuance of $10.00 as an incentive for members to establish payroll allotments for PAC or increase their current allotments.  Listed below are the requirements for the promotion:

1.      Enrollee must be a current NASCOE member.

2.      The establishment of a payroll allotment is required.

3.      New enrollees or existing PAC members may receive a check for $10.00 with a minimum $3.00 allotment or an increase of $3.00.

4.      Members may only receive one PAC Promotion.

5.      Checks will not be disbursed until enrollment form is received by Charla Daly.    Checks will be disbursed after allotment begins

All Members that start a $3 allotment or increase their allotment by $3 between now and the National Convention in Boise, ID, will get a $10 and be entered in a drawing where 5 lucky persons will win $100 each at the National Convention!

 

The State with the largest percentage increase in PAC donaors will receive $500 for their state association at the National Covention in Boise, ID.
